ul.acf-image-select-list li {
	display: inline-block;
	margin: 5px;
	text-align: center;
}
ul.acf-image-select-list li input {
	display: none;
}
.acf-image-select-list .acf-image-select img{
	border: solid 4px #D9D9D9;
}
.acf-image-select-list .acf-image-select .acf-image-select-selected img{
	border: solid 4px #7A7A7A;
}

.layout_sidebars .acf-image-select, .layout_sidebars .acf-radio-list li{
	max-width: 28%;
	-webkit-box-sizing: border-box;
	-moz-box-sizing: border-box;
	box-sizing: border-box;
}
.layout_sidebars .acf-radio-list li{
	margin-right: 7px !important;
}
.layout_sidebars .acf-image-select img, .layout_sidebars .acf-radio-list li img{
	max-width: 100%;
	-webkit-box-sizing: border-box;
	-moz-box-sizing: border-box;
	box-sizing: border-box;
}

.layout_sidebars .acf-radio-list img{
	border: solid 3px #fff;
}

.layout_sidebars .acf-radio-list .selected img{
	border: solid 3px #D9D9D9;
}

.hidden-label .item-title{
	display: none;
}
.hidden-label .acf-radio-list li{
	font-size: 0px;
}


/* styles for the radio buttons that have the class 'flo-image-select' */
.flo-image-select  input[type=radio]{
	display: none;
}


